Lazy Ants aka Filippo Fiorini is a dj and producer born in Fiuggi, living in Rome since 2000 where, at the age of 20, he started his career as producer.He immediately attracts the attention of lots of blogs such as Big Stereo and Discobelle posting his bootleg,but his career as dj starts some year later, when the Deepsession crew introduces him to the Rome's clubbing scene.Shortly afterwards the Lazy Ants project borns, initially in partnership with NT89, and supported by names like Congorock,Crookers and Bloody Beetroots.He starts making the first important remixs for Steed Lord, Act Yo Age, Crookers, Larry Tee, Lauren Flax, Kubo,Blatta & Inesha feat. Congorock for labels like Southern Fried, Man recordings and Ultra. In 2010 he produces with the famous hip-hop italian producer Big Fish the album "Fragile" of the rapper Nelsi. 2011 is a lucky year for Lazy Ants who makes the track "M.i.n.i" for the Mixmash, the Dj Laidback Luke's label, two tracks for the Southern Fried Na Ciphra compilation (used by the legend Fatboy Slim to remix Bust Dem Up by Crookers) and Me Road. Lazy Ants produces with his friends Crookers and His Majesty Andre the track "Carcola", included in the new Crookers album "Dr. Gonzo".With Nic Sarno, Dargen D'amico and Schlachthofbronx he produces "Solo Un Demo", the first single of the Macrobiotics project (Nic Sarno & Dargen D'amico).He also works with the Pink Is Punk for the track "Skull & Banana", which is included in the their album (Universal Music), then he makes two techno Eps: Idiot House, in collaboration with Acid Jack for the label of the australian dj and the other one with Rob Threezy for the Boemklatsch record, supported by artists like Drop The Lime, Switch, Feadz, Mixhell, Rebotini , Autokratz, Groove Armada & Faithless (which is included in the Pete Tong's compilation "All Gone" 2012).He remixes WaxMotif (Downright/Ministry of sound Au),Dj Birdee (Woot Records), Phantom's Revenge ( La Valigetta),Nic Sarno ( Esp), Oh Snap ( Ego), Acid Jacks ( One Love), Silver Medallion ( Get Right Records), The Whip ( Southern Fried), Autokratz ( Bad Life), Urchins ( Ministry of Sound ) and Booty Call Records.In 2012 his new ep, which including "Stalker" produced with Keith & Supabeatz, will be out on the label Bad Life, also a remix for Mixhell & Rebotini out on the Black Strobe Record, and many others. In 2013 have released an Ep in collaboration with The Phantom's Revenge out on Nervous Records.Back in 2015 with remix for Heavy of Crookers, big remix for hit OT Genesis with Stabber an ep with Stabber out on Luckybeard,and Ghetto House EP for Booty Call Records. In May 2015 he joins in Dogozillaempire , best italian hip hop producer crew. @Lazy-Ants

It was in the year 2006 that Top Billin Soundsystem first made themselves a household name in Helsinki with bootleg remixes, mixtapes and an ever-consistent monthly clubnight. That was just the beginning. The duo's first ever 12” EP, then ended up becaming the number one selling item at Turntablelab.com, favored by club DJ’s and party music lovers around the world. Fast forward to 2013 and that classic EP has been followed by more top selling releases as well as the evolution of Top Billin into a record label baosting a back-catalog of artists ranging from America to Chile, Russia, Japan and beyond. Besides running the record label and crafting forward thinking club tunes, Top Billin has become a well oiled party machine, rocking shows around the globe from Paris to Berlin, Moscow and New York, with the biggest names in the business and countless other club favorites. They even supported M.I.A. on one of her sought after tours. With roots deep in house, hip-hop, dancehall, funk and boogie, Top Billin like to keep their music up-to-date and cutting-edge, both in the shows they play and the records they put out. With fans that include names such as Diplo, Laidback Luke, Drop The Lime, Steve Aoki, Sinden, Brodinski, DJ Godfather, DJ Funk, Dada Life and even DJ Tiesto, they're an independant dance music label, we suggest you keep an eye on. You may have even heard remixes and releases for labels like Mad Decent, Dim Mak, Unruly, Trouble & Bass, Kitsune, and a whole load more. We're not name dropping here. Just laying down the facts. London based producer and DJ, Reso a.k.a Alex Melia is a man with a fascination for all things robotic and futuristic. His hybrid of hyper beats and tech-basslines sometimes feel more suited to a post-apocalyptic Tokyo than the contemporary concrete of most dubstep and we dig it. "A truly inspiring experience his music’s mech-mania induced synthesesia conjures images of neon-tinged neo-Japanese cityscapes, powerful hulking automatons and violent bassline machismo." Melia's much anticipated debut LP, ‘Tangram’ was released on Civil Music back in November 2012. As most had expected it shook some serious ground and garnered praise and support from the likes of Mixmag as album of the month, XLR8R, Guardian and MTV as well as from bass music personalities such as Liam Howlett, Skrillex, KOAN Sound, Rusko, Starkey and more. A landmark in the producer's so far pretty underground career, the 13-track LP showcased his flair for intricate programming and love for all things jazz (as a trained jazz drummer), electronica, bass and drums. In 2013, Reso sits at the peak of a new breed of electronic music producers and we're not the only ones to take notice. Within a relatively short space of time, Reso has remixed artists as diverse as Carl Cox, DJ Kentaro, Om Unit, KOAN Sound, Drop The Lime and Buraka Som Sistema. On this week’s Snacky Tunes, Darin and Greg Bresnitz are not only talking about music and food, but movies, too! Our hosts are joined in the studio by John Woods of Nitehawk Cinema in Williamsburg, Brooklyn. John got interested in movies when he opened his video rental store called Real Life Video in Williamsburg several years ago. Hear about how John went from video rentals to showing them on the big screen. Tune in to learn about the food and drink served at Nitehawk, and how John had to fight an eighty year-old law that prevented alcohol from being served at movie theaters. Hear about the film selection at Nitehawk – from first runs to old classics. Drop The Lime is live in the studio- his first appearance since the first episode of Snacky Tunes. Listen to Luca talk about the influence of blues and rockabilly on his electronic music, and how he has evolved since his beginnings with Trouble and Bass. Drop The Lime plays some of the tracks from his upcoming album live, and talks about eating on the road with Greg.
